Skip to content

Commit 2928db8

Browse files
committed
Bug 1991124 - Fix ESLint require-jsdoc issues in genai code. r=firefox-ai-ml-reviewers,ngrato
Differential Revision: https://phabricator.services.mozilla.com/D266631 UltraBlame original commit: 7fa650ea77ad31bfb04fab626afbfcb7a8c9b3bf
1 parent 5e0bec8 commit 2928db8

File tree

4 files changed

+84
-58
lines changed

4 files changed

+84
-58
lines changed

browser/components/genai/PageAssistChild.sys.mjs

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-110,6 +110,24 @@ mjs
110110
}
111111
)
112112
;
113+
/
114+
*
115+
*
116+
*
117+
Represents
118+
a
119+
child
120+
actor
121+
for
122+
getting
123+
page
124+
data
125+
from
126+
the
127+
browser
128+
.
129+
*
130+
/
113131
export
114132
class
115133
PageAssistChild

browser/components/genai/content/page-assist.mjs

Lines changed: 32 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-214,6 +214,22 @@ text
214214
mjs
215215
"
216216
;
217+
/
218+
*
219+
*
220+
*
221+
A
222+
custom
223+
element
224+
for
225+
managing
226+
the
227+
page
228+
assistant
229+
input
230+
.
231+
*
232+
/
217233
export
218234
class
219235
PageAssistInput
@@ -402,6 +418,22 @@ input
402418
PageAssistInput
403419
)
404420
;
421+
/
422+
*
423+
*
424+
*
425+
A
426+
custom
427+
element
428+
for
429+
managing
430+
the
431+
page
432+
assistant
433+
sidebar
434+
.
435+
*
436+
/
405437
export
406438
class
407439
PageAssist

browser/components/genai/content/smart-assist.mjs

Lines changed: 34 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-209,6 +209,22 @@ smartAssistPage
209209
html
210210
"
211211
;
212+
/
213+
*
214+
*
215+
*
216+
A
217+
custom
218+
element
219+
for
220+
managing
221+
the
222+
smart
223+
assistant
224+
sidebar
225+
.
226+
*
227+
/
212228
export
213229
class
214230
SmartAssist
@@ -743,6 +759,24 @@ full
743759
page
744760
UX
745761
*
762+
*
763+
param
764+
{
765+
boolean
766+
}
767+
enable
768+
*
769+
Whether
770+
or
771+
not
772+
to
773+
override
774+
the
775+
new
776+
tab
777+
page
778+
.
779+
*
746780
/
747781
_applyNewTabOverride
748782
(

eslint-rollouts.config.mjs

Lines changed: 0 additions & 58 deletions
Original file line numberDiff line numberDiff line change
@@ -5035,64 +5035,6 @@ browser
50355035
/
50365036
components
50375037
/
5038-
genai
5039-
/
5040-
PageAssistChild
5041-
.
5042-
sys
5043-
.
5044-
mjs
5045-
"
5046-
"
5047-
browser
5048-
/
5049-
components
5050-
/
5051-
genai
5052-
/
5053-
content
5054-
/
5055-
page
5056-
-
5057-
assist
5058-
.
5059-
mjs
5060-
"
5061-
"
5062-
browser
5063-
/
5064-
components
5065-
/
5066-
genai
5067-
/
5068-
content
5069-
/
5070-
smart
5071-
-
5072-
assist
5073-
.
5074-
mjs
5075-
"
5076-
"
5077-
browser
5078-
/
5079-
components
5080-
/
5081-
genai
5082-
/
5083-
tests
5084-
/
5085-
browser
5086-
/
5087-
browser_page_assist_actors
5088-
.
5089-
js
5090-
"
5091-
"
5092-
browser
5093-
/
5094-
components
5095-
/
50965038
mozcachedohttp
50975039
/
50985040
MozCachedOHTTPProtocolHandler

0 commit comments

Comments
 (0)